Ozark follows Marty Byrde (Jason Bateman), a financial advisor who drags his family from Chicago to the Missouri Ozarks after a money-laundering scheme goes wrong. To keep his family safe from a Mexican drug cartel, he must set up a massive laundering operation in a summer resort community where danger hides behind every boat dock. : This details the audio codec and channel layout. AAC (Advanced Audio Coding) is a highly efficient audio compression standard, while 5.1 indicates a six-channel surround sound setup (five full-bandwidth channels and one low-frequency effects channel).
